PENTWATER, Mich. (WOOD) - Two people are in jail accused of crashing a stolen pickup truck through the entrance of a business and stealing numerous items.
Travis William Malone, 18, from Ludington was arrested shortly after the crime and charged with breaking and entering a building with intent (a 10-year felony). His bond is $50,000.
The search for the second suspect ended Tuesday in Ludington when a felony warrant for breaking and entering with intent and being a habitual offender was served. He is also facing outstanding warrants in Mason County where he is currently in jail. He will be transferred to Oceana County and arraigned there for the break-in.
The suspects stole the red Ford F-250 pickup truck in Ludington in Mason County around 3:44 a.m. Saturday, the Ludington Daily News reports.
Then the suspects crashed into The Wishing Well, 9580 U.S. 31 in Pentwater in Oceana County, around 5 a.m. Sunday, police told 24 Hour News 8.

At :35, the video shows the suspects crash into the store. One of the the suspects got out of the truck and stole alcohol. Then the video shows him stuffing cigarettes into the pockets of his hooded sweatshirt. The other suspect then drove the truck out of the store, and the other suspect walked out. Further along in the video, one of the suspects is seen coming back into the store to steal more bottles of alcohol.
The suspects then fled the scene before police responded to the burglary alarm.
